Prepreg Composites: The Future of High-Performance Manufacturing
Prepreg composites are advanced engineered materials made by pre-impregnating reinforcing fibers, such as carbon fiber or fiberglass, with a carefully controlled amount of resin. Unlike traditional wet layup methods, prepreg composites materials arrive ready to use, ensuring consistent resin distribution, improved strength, and superior surface quality. These materials are widely used in industries where performance, durability, and lightweight construction are essential, including aerospace, automotive, marine, sporting goods, and renewable energy. Manufacturers choose prepreg composites because they reduce material waste, simplify production, and deliver highly repeatable results. Once laid into a mold, prepreg laminates are typically cured under heat and pressure using an autoclave or an out-of-autoclave process, creating components with exceptional structural integrity. Their excellent mechanical properties, fatigue resistance, and dimensional stability make them ideal for demanding applications.
